package model
import (
"fmt"
"strings"
"time"
"github.com/mnako/letters"
"golang.org/x/net/html"
"gorm.io/gorm"
)
type Mail struct {
ID uint
CreatedAt time.Time `gorm:"not null"`
Date string `gorm:"not null;index:search"`
Source string `gorm:"not null"`
SearchText string `gorm:"not null"`
}
func (m *Mail) BeforeSave(tx *gorm.DB) (err error) {
em, err := m.Parse()
if err != nil {
return
}
m.CreatedAt = em.Headers.Date
m.Date = em.Headers.Date.Format("2006-01-02")
m.SearchText = fmt.Sprintf("%s %s %s", em.Headers.Subject, em.Text, extractText(em.HTML))
return
}
func (m *Mail) Parse() (letters.Email, error) {
r := strings.NewReader(m.Source)
return letters.ParseEmail(r)
}
func CreatedAt(s string) func(db *gorm.DB) *gorm.DB {
return func(db *gorm.DB) *gorm.DB {
sw := strings.TrimSpace(s)
if sw == "" {
return db
}
return db.Where("date = ?", s)
}
}
func MatchWord(w string) func(db *gorm.DB) *gorm.DB {
return func(db *gorm.DB) *gorm.DB {
sw := strings.TrimSpace(w)
if sw == "" {
return db
}
wsw := fmt.Sprintf("%%%s%%", sw)
return db.Where("source LIKE ? OR search_text LIKE ?", wsw, wsw)
}
}
func ExpireDays(expireDays int) func(db *gorm.DB) *gorm.DB {
return func(db *gorm.DB) *gorm.DB {
t := time.Now()
return db.Where("created_at < ?", t.AddDate(0, 0, -expireDays))
}
}
func Paginate(page int, per int) func(db *gorm.DB) *gorm.DB {
return func(db *gorm.DB) *gorm.DB {
if page <= 0 {
page = 1
}
switch {
case per > 100:
per = 100
case per <= 0:
per = 10
}
offset := (page - 1) * per
return db.Offset(offset).Limit(per)
}
}
func extractText(htmlStr string) (text string) {
r := strings.NewReader(htmlStr)
z := html.NewTokenizer(r)
loop := true
for loop {
tt := z.Next()
loop = tt != html.ErrorToken
if loop {
switch tt {
case html.TextToken:
text = fmt.Sprintf("%s %s", text, z.Text())
}
}
}
return
}
